Red Faction

Awesome...

If You liked the retro movie "Total Recall" (, or the newer redux that's not as good), then You will most likely enjoy the story of this game, as it was made to be that movie's game, but they lost the rights before it released, and had to change a few things... it's typical FPS fare for the time, looks, and controls well enough, but was literally the first game of it's genre to have destructable environments, as in blowing holes through walls, or even floors to get to new areas, rooms, or secrets, & this is used a lot in the story mode, but in multiplayer is where this shines... I used to blast holes into the walls with rockets making staircases to camping spots, then climb to them, & snipe, or just wait for friends, bots, or people online to come try to get the ________ (insert things people want in the game like rockets, or big armor), My hole was above. IDK if the multiplayer works here on GOGlike it used to on PC, but this game can be loads of fun with friends, or strangers alike!
